Abstract

A vancomycin-sparing guideline for suspected late-onset sepsis helped reduce vancomycin usage in our level-4 neonatal intensive care unit. Significant reduction in overall vancomycin use, with its likely unit-wide beneficial downstream effects, may need to be measured against the rare case of meth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us infection and delayed effective therapy.
